2,4-Dichloro-3-methylpyridine Use and Manufacturing
1.6 M n-Butyl lithium in hexanes (3.75 mL, 6.0 mmol) and anhydrous THF (5 mL) were added to a flame-dried flask under nitrogen atmosphere. This solution was cooled to-78C, 2, 4- Dichloro-pyridine was added dropwise while stirring and the mixture was stirred at-78C for 30 min after which time methyliodide (0.374 mL, 6.0 mmol) was added dropwise at-78C. This mixture was stirred at-78C for lh under nitrogen atmosphere after which time glacial ACOH (0.114 mL, 2.0 mmol) was added to give a reaction mixture pH (wet pH paper) of 5-6. The reaction mixture was dissolved in Et2O (100 mL), the organic layer was washed with water (10 mL), then brine (10 ML), dried with MGS04, and the solvent was evaporated in vacuo to give an oil which was purified by flash chromatography using HEXANES : CH2CL2 (50: 50 V/V) to hexanes: CH2CL2 : EtOAc (50: 47: 3 v/v/v) to give 2, 4-dichloro-3-methyl-pyridine as a white solid (589 mg, 72percent). It was noted that 2, 4-dichloro-3- methyl-pyridine readily sublimates in vacuo. 'H NMR (CD30D, 400 MHz) 8 8.15 (d, 1H), 7.46 (d, 1H), 2.50 (s, 3H). LRMS calculated for C6H5CL2N : 160.98, found: (MH) + 161.9.To a solution 2, 4-dichloro-3-methyrpyridine (2.0 g, 12.3 mmol) in anhydrous carbon tetrachloride (50 mL) was added recrystallized l-bromopyrrolidine-2, 5-dione (2.25 g, 12.6 mmol) and benzoyl benzenecarboperoxoate (400 mg, 1.6 mmol). The mixture was stirred at reflux for 2 hours. After cooling to room temperature, the solid material was removed by filtration and washed with carbon tetrachloride (2 x 10 mL). The filtrate was recovered and evaporated. The solid product was dried in vacuo, affording 3-(bromomethyl)-2, 4-dichloropyridine (2.9 g , 99% yield). The product was used without further purification.
Used for preparation of imidazo[4,5-b]pyridine derivatives for treatment of diseases caused by gastric acid.
